Standard allergy doses of antihistamines are often insufficient for mast cell activation syndrome (MCAS). The EAACI/GA2LEN/EuroGuiDerm/APAAACI international urticaria guideline recommends up to fourfold doses of second-generation H1 antihistamines as Step 2 treatment when standard doses fail after 2–4 weeks (Zuberbier et al. 2022). MCAS specialists (Afrin, Molderings) have adopted and extended this principle for MCAS management (Afrin 2013) (Molderings et al. 2016).
The fourfold up-dosing recommendation originates from chronic spontaneous urticaria (CSU) guidelines, not MCAS-specific trials. A systematic review found only five small, mostly historical trials of H1 antihistamines in primary mast cell activation syndromes (Nurmatov et al. 2015). The application to MCAS is based on shared pathophysiology (histamine-mediated symptoms from mast cell degranulation) and expert clinical practice, not direct randomized evidence in MCAS populations.
1 Safety of Higher-Than-Standard Doses
A study of 59 patients receiving above-fourfold doses (median 8\(\\times\), range 5–12\(\\times\) standard) found that only 10% reported side effects, predominantly somnolence, with no serious adverse events (Elzen et al. 2017). A systematic review of up-dosing across multiple second-generation antihistamines confirmed that higher doses increase drowsiness (9.5–59% of patients) but produce no dose-dependent systemic complications (Podder, Dhabal, and Chakraborty 2023).

Drug-specific notes.
Cetirizine: MCAS dosing per Afrin: 10 mg every 12 hours, escalating to 20 mg BID if needed (Afrin 2013). Maximum studied in clinical trials: 20 mg/day (matching the 2\(\\times\) dose used in the severe protocol in Chapter Urgent Action Plan for Severe Cases).
Fexofenadine: Highest responder rate among all second-generation antihistamines at up-dosing (83%) (Podder, Dhabal, and Chakraborty 2023). Maintains cardiac safety at 4\(\\times\) doses; does not cause tachyphylaxis. MCAS dosing per Afrin: 180 mg every 12 hours (Afrin 2013). Stepwise escalation: 240→360→540→720 mg/day at 1–2 week intervals. In long COVID, fexofenadine 180 mg + famotidine 40 mg daily for 20 days resolved fatigue in 43% and brain fog in 43% of patients (Salvucci et al. 2023).
Loratadine: The fourfold recommendation applies class-wide, but direct clinical trial data for loratadine above 20 mg/day are limited. Its active metabolite desloratadine at 4\(\\times\) showed only 30% response in CSU (Podder, Dhabal, and Chakraborty 2023). MCAS dosing per Afrin: 10 mg two to three times daily (Afrin 2013).
Rupatadine: Unique dual action (H1 antagonist + PAF antagonist) makes it particularly relevant for MCAS, where mast cells release both histamine and PAF (see Section Guideline Origin and Extrapolation below). Studied at 20 mg and 40 mg in cold urticaria (Magerl et al. 2015); dose-dependent somnolence at 40 mg. In mastocytosis, 20 mg produced significant reductions in Darier’s sign, flushing, tachycardia, and headache (Izquierdo et al. 2024). No formal CSU up-dosing recommendation exists specifically for rupatadine.
2.1 Rupatadine: Special Considerations for MCAS
Rupatadine occupies a unique position among H1 antihistamines due to its triple mechanism: H1 antagonism, PAF antagonism (31\(\\times\) more potent than loratadine), and direct mast cell stabilization (inhibits IL-8 release by 80%, VEGF by 73%, histamine by 88%) Piñero-González et al. (2017). This multi-target profile means that rupatadine at standard doses may already provide mast cell control that other H1 antihistamines only achieve at higher doses.

3 H2 Antihistamine Dosing: Standard vs. MCAS
Unlike H1 antihistamines, there is no equivalent formal guideline recommending H2 up-dosing for MCAS. Higher H2 doses are based on MCAS specialist clinical practice (Afrin 2013) (Molderings et al. 2016) and extrapolation from FDA-approved doses for pathological hypersecretory conditions (e.g., Zollinger-Ellison syndrome). The H1+H2 combination is standard MCAS practice, but H2 dose escalation is expert opinion, not guideline-driven.

Famotidine dose escalation. Start 20 mg once daily; increase to 20 mg BID after 1–2 weeks; if insufficient, increase to 40 mg BID (Afrin 2013). Drying effects may increase at higher doses; titrate slowly. In long COVID, famotidine 40 mg daily combined with fexofenadine 180 mg reduced tachycardia in 57% of patients (Salvucci et al. 2023).
Cimetidine dose escalation. Standard MCAS dose is 400 mg BID (800 mg/day). Can escalate to 800 mg BID for refractory symptoms. Cimetidine retains unique immunomodulatory properties (T-cell enhancement, NK cell activation) not shared by famotidine (Goldstein 1986), making it the preferred H2 blocker when immunomodulation is desired (see Section cimetidine antiviral synergy). However, strong CYP450 inhibition (1A2, 2D6, 3A4) requires careful drug interaction review before dose escalation.

8 Practical Up-Dosing Protocol for ME/CFS Patients
Prerequisite: Clinical suspicion of MCAS (see Section tVNS Caution in Severe ME/CFS) and inadequate response to standard-dose H1+H2 combination after 4 weeks.
Step 1 (Weeks 1–4): Standard doses
- H1: One second-generation antihistamine at standard dose (e.g., rupatadine 10 mg, cetirizine 10 mg, or fexofenadine 180 mg once daily)
- H2: Famotidine 20 mg once daily
Step 2 (Weeks 5–8): Double frequency
- H1: Increase to BID dosing (e.g., cetirizine 10 mg BID, fexofenadine 180 mg BID, rupatadine 20 mg/day)
- H2: Increase to famotidine 20 mg BID
- Monitor: Drowsiness (main dose-limiting side effect), mood changes
Step 3 (Weeks 9–12): Up-dose if needed
- H1: Increase toward 4\(\\times\) standard (e.g., cetirizine 20 mg BID, fexofenadine 360 mg BID)
- H2: Increase to famotidine 40 mg BID
- Escalate one agent at a time to identify which provides additional benefit
Step 4: Add-on therapies if still insufficient
- Mast cell stabilizer (ketotifen, cromolyn)
- Leukotriene inhibitor (montelukast)
- Omalizumab (per urticaria Step 3 guideline (Zuberbier et al. 2022))
ME/CFS-specific caution: Introduce dose changes more slowly than in general MCAS populations. ME/CFS patients with medication sensitivity phenotypes (Section Medication Sensitivity Phenotypes) may not tolerate rapid escalation. Consider 2-week intervals between dose steps rather than 1-week intervals.
